Vanot - Savar Kundla, Amreli
Vanot is a village situated in the Savar Kundla taluka of Amreli district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 25 km from the tehsil headquarters in Savar Kundla and around 67 km from the district headquarters in Amreli. Vanot village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Vanot is 515823. The village covers a total geographical area of 1150.23 hectares and falls under the 364530 pincode. Savar Kundla is the nearest town, located about 25 km away.
Vanot village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Savarkundla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Amreli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Vanot
As per Census 2011, Vanot village has a total population of 1,742 people, consisting of 831 males and 911 females. The village has 329 households and a sex ratio of 1,096 females per 1,000 males. There are 219 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,015 literate and 727 illiterate residents. Additionally, 66 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Vanot are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,742 | 831 | 911 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 219 | 104 | 115 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 66 | 35 | 31 |
| Literate Population | 1,015 | 571 | 444 |
| Illiterate Population | 727 | 260 | 467 |

Transport and Connectivity of Vanot
Public transport in the Vanot is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Vanot.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Savar Kundla to Vanot is about 25 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Amreli to Vanot is about 67 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Vanot
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Vanot village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Vanot
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Vanot village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
